Delve into the enduring world of metalworking with ""Practical Forging and Art Smithing"" by Thomas F. Googerty. This meticulously prepared republication offers a comprehensive guide to the time-honored crafts of forging and art smithing. Explore the techniques and principles behind shaping iron and other metals, from basic forging to more intricate ironwork designs.

Whether you are a seasoned metalworker or simply curious about the blacksmith's art, this book provides a wealth of practical knowledge. Discover the tools, materials, and methods essential for creating durable and beautiful metal objects. Learn about the processes involved in forging, shaping, and finishing metalwork, gaining insights into a craft that has captivated artisans for centuries.

Perfect for enthusiasts of metal crafts, this book serves as a valuable resource for understanding the fundamentals of forging and art smithing. Journey into a world where fire and metal meet, creating works of lasting strength and beauty.
